Peerless-AV Showcase 2026

Now in its sixth year, the Peerless-AV Showcase 2026 recently took place from 12 to 13 May at Lord’s Cricket Ground in central London.

2026 for Peerless-AV’s Showcase delivered an event with visitor numbers up and a wide range of new and innovative solutions. Lord’s Cricket Ground continues to deliver as an ideal venue for space and accessibility for Peerless-AV, celebrating its 85th anniversary in 2026. “Since we organised our inaugural event in 2021, the AV market has responded positively, so now reaching our sixth consecutive year feels like a significant milestone”, said Keith Dutch, Managing Director EMEA, Peerless-AV. “The continued growth and development of our event reflects the unbelievable ongoing support we receive within the AV community – from the market leading manufacturers who exhibit, the industry voices that deliver seminars and panels to the diverse range of attendees from across the Professional AV spectrum and End User vertical markets.” As AV continues to evolve and blurred lines emerge between AV, connectivity, unified communication and collaboration, showcases are almost a necessity to understand the hardware and software implications for vendors, integrators

and their customers, as well as explore the new technology that is constantly released to improve the end user AV and UC&C experience everywhere. Ecosystem Enabler Whilst Peerless-AV is a vendor, the company continues to facilitate and promote other vendors because its business model is not based solely on selling its own mounting systems and AV infrastructure products. It operates as an ecosystem enabler within the AV industry. Peerless-AV products are often installed alongside displays, digital signage, LED walls, cameras, collaboration tools and AV-over-IP solutions, and thus events are essential for integrators. Since MSPs and resellers rarely buy standalone devices and systems, almost always designing complete projects involving multiple vendors. Live demonstrations and having experts with technical know-how on hand are essential for AV innovation sales today. Certainly, for Tony Manthe, UK Channel Sales Manager at Scala, he finds the event beneficial, citing it as, “one of his favourite events of the year”, highlighting the opportunity for “real conversations with the right people” and saying the event feels more focused and relationship-driven than larger trade shows.
